How much do remote porter jobs pay per hour?

As of May 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ote porter in Virginia is $15.35,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.61 and $16.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Porter,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Porter, you need basic facility management knowledge, strong organizational skills, and experience in custodial or support services, often supported by a high school diploma. Familiarity with scheduling software, communication tools, and facility monitoring systems is typically required. Dependability, attention to detail, and effective communication are standout soft skills for this position. These abilities ensure smooth operations, efficient coordination, and a safe, well-maintained environment in remote or distributed settings.

What are the main challenges faced by a Remote Porter, and how can I prepare for them?

As a Remote Porter, one of the main challenges is maintaining clear communication and coordination with onsite staff while working offsite. Since your support tasks—such as managing deliveries, scheduling maintenance, and assisting residents virtually—require attention to detail and prompt responses, effective use of communication tools and proactive problem-solving are essential. You’ll also need to adapt quickly to shifting priorities and handle multiple requests simultaneously. Preparing by familiarizing yourself with property management software and developing strong organizational skills can help you excel in this role.

What are Remote Porters?

Remote Porters are individuals who provide facilities management and support services for buildings or properties from a remote location. They may handle tasks such as coordinating cleaning schedules, managing security systems, monitoring building access, and responding to maintenance requests using technology and communication tools. This role is especially common in modern buildings equipped with smart systems, allowing porters to oversee operations without being physically present. Remote Porters help ensure that facilities run smoothly and efficiently, even when on-site staff is limited.
